Tutorial_4

Páginas: 4 (777 palabras) Publicado: 30 de octubre de 2015
4.1 EL DISEÑO ARQUITECTÓNICO.
Arquitectura de software: estructura de las estructuras del sistema.
Comprende los componentes del software, sus propiedades y las relaciones entre
ellos.
Diseñadas enarquitectura en grande y en pequeño.
Afecta al desempeño, potencia, distribución y mantenimiento de un sistema.
Representación que capacita al ingeniero del software para:




Analizar laefectividad del diseño para la consecución de los
requisitos fijados.
Considerar las alternativas arquitectónicas en una etapa en la cual
hacer cambios en el diseño es relativamente fácil.
Reducir losriesgos asociados a la construcción del software.

Componente de software: tan sencillo como componente de programa o tan
complicado como bases de datos.
Propiedades de un componente: características quepermiten saber cómo
interactúan con otros componentes.
Descomposición arquitectónica:
características del sistema.

sirve

para

discutir

requerimientos

y

Arquitectura en grande: se interesa por laarquitectura de sistemas complejos.
Arquitectura en pequeño: se interesa por programas individuales.
Ventajas de diseñar/documentar la arquitectura de software:
1. Comunicación con participantes:dado que es a alto nivel, permite esta
característica.
2. Análisis del sistema: para la correcta toma de decisiones sobre el sistema.
3. Reutilización a gran escala: es posible ya que pararequerimientos similares,
arquitecturas similares.

ESTILOS ARQUITECTÓNICOS.
Todo estilo contiene:
1.
2.
3.
4.

Componentes que realizan una función específica.
Conectores entre componentes para comunicación.Restricciones que definen dicha comunicación.
Modelos semánticos para entender por completo el sistema.

Clasificación de los estilos:


Centrados a datos: hay un almacén de datos al cual loscomponentes
acceden para hacer cambios a los datos.



De flujo de datos: datos de entrada manipulados por algún componente en
datos de salida.



Llamada y retorno: permite crear estructuras fáciles de...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Tutorial_4
  • Tutorial_4
  • Tutorial_4
  • Tutorial_4
  • Tutorial_4

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S